EOAC is on United’s mind
HANOVERTON — United’s baseball team injected a little excitement into the Eastern Ohio Athletic Conference race by besting Columbiana 4-1 on a cold Wednesday afternoon.
United is 8-5 and 7-1 in the EOAC. Columbiana (10-1, 4-1) was ranked third in the Div. III state coaches’ poll coming into the game.
United is still in good shape to make an upset run at the league title as the Eagles lead Columbiana 3-1 in a game that was suspended in the second inning on Monday.
“We did not see it coming but we wll take it,” United coach Bob Manfull said. “Columbiana is still a great team, but we just managed to have a good game. That’s the kind of league it is this year. Anyone can beat anyone on a given day.”
The Eagles have two games with East Palestine and one game with Wellsville left outside of the Columbiana contest. That Columbiana game will be completed on Tuesday at Firestone Park.
Grant Knight led the Eagles with two hits and three runs against the Clippers. Trent Newburn added two RBIs. Andrew Winn and Tyler Dickens had a hit and RBI each.
Nevin Hahlen went the distance and struck out eight.
“He wasn’t even supposed to pitch today,” Manfull said. “We only told him at 4:30.”
Zachary Pleska had two hits for Columbiana who managed just three total hits in the game.
United hosts Carrollton today.
Columbiana is at Mooney today.

Lisbon 23,
Leetonia 0
LISBON — A day after Leetonia won its first game of the season, Lisbon was not about to offer a repeat performance.
Lisbon totaled 13 hits — all singles — in a 23-0 win over the Bears on Wednesday.
Owens had three hits and three RBIs to lead the winners. Hunter Sturgeon had two hits and three RBIs. Brayden Flory had two hits and two RBIs.
Leetonia got one hit from Jacob McCool.
Lisbon is 7-7 and will be at Crestview today.

Salem 10, Alliance 0
SALEM — Salem’s Carson Rhodes struck out eight on 81 pitches to lead the Quakers to a 10-0 win over Alliance on Wednesday in Eastern Buckeye Conference play.
Salem is now 10-3 and 5-3 in the league and till be at South Range on Saturday.
Rhodes also had a double and a single with three RBIs. Blaize Exline had a home run and single. Gavin Wilms had two hits as did Cayden Burt.

SOFTBALL
Salem 8, Carrollton 7
CARROLLTON — Salem’s softball team had to hang on to defeat Carrollton 8-7 on Wednesday in Eastern Buckeye Conference action.
Salem is 10-9 and 3-4 in the league.
Mack Zumbar had three hits and two RBIs for the Quakers. Rylie Troy had a double, single and an RBI. Chase Toy had two hits and an RBI.
Salem is at Marlington today.
